Message Bus

Architecture

A message bus, within the context of cryptocurrency, options trading, and financial derivatives, represents a distributed communication infrastructure facilitating asynchronous data exchange between various components. It decouples producers and consumers of data, enabling independent scaling and resilience across systems like order management, risk engines, and market data feeds. This architecture promotes modularity, allowing for the addition or modification of services without disrupting the entire ecosystem, a critical feature in high-frequency trading environments and decentralized finance (DeFi) protocols. The design often incorporates message queues and brokers to ensure reliable delivery and ordering of messages, crucial for maintaining consistency in complex derivative pricing and settlement processes.